Overview Rabcer IT 20mg/150mg Capsule
Gastroesophageal reflux disease (GERD) and peptic ulcers are effectively managed with the combined-action capsule, Rabcer IT 20mg/150mg. This medication targets acidity symptoms like heartburn, stomach upset, and pain, providing both acid neutralization and enhanced gas expulsion for improved comfort. Dosage and treatment duration for Rabcer IT 20mg/150mg Capsules should follow your physician's instructions; the prescribed regimen will be tailored to your individual needs and response. Consistent medication use as directed is crucial; premature discontinuation may lead to symptom recurrence and condition exacerbation. Complete transparency with your healthcare provider regarding all other medications is vital, as potential interactions exist. Common side effects, such as abdominal pain, altered bowel habits (diarrhea or constipation), headache, gas, fatigue, and increased salivation, are generally transient. However, any concerning side effects warrant immediate medical attention. Drowsiness and dizziness are potential effects; avoid driving or activities requiring alertness until you assess your response. Alcohol consumption should be avoided due to its potential to intensify drowsiness. Lifestyle adjustments, including incorporating cold milk into your diet and limiting the intake of hot beverages, spicy foods, and chocolate, can positively influence treatment outcomes. Pre-existing liver conditions, pregnancy, plans for pregnancy, or breastfeeding should be disclosed to your doctor prior to initiating Rabcer IT 20mg/150mg Capsule therapy.

How Rabcer IT 20mg/150mg Capsule works:
Rabcer IT capsules, containing 20mg rabeprazole and 150mg itopride, combine a proton pump inhibitor (PPI) with a prokinetic agent. Rabeprazole diminishes stomach acid production, alleviating acid indigestion and heartburn. Itopride, a centrally acting prokinetic, suppresses nausea by influencing the brain's vomiting center and simultaneously enhances gastrointestinal motility, facilitating improved food transit through the upper digestive tract.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holCAUTION
Exercise caution when combining alcohol and Rabcer IT 20mg/150mg Capsules. Physician consultation is recommended.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The use of Rabcer IT 20mg/150mg Capsules during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is limited, animal studies indicate potential harm to a fetus. A physician will assess the potential benefits against these risks before prescribing. Seek medical advice before taking this medication.
Breast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Data on the use of Rabcer IT 20mg/150mg capsules while breastfeeding is lacking. Seek medical advice from your physician.
DrivingUNSAFE
Taking Rabcer IT 20mg/150mg Capsules might reduce attentiveness, impair vision, or cause drowsiness and dizziness. Driving should be avoided if these effects are experienced.
Kidney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Data on Rabcer IT 20mg/150mg Capsule use in individuals with renal impairment is scarce. Seek medical advice from your physician.
LiverCAUTION
Individuals with severe hepatic impairment should exercise caution when using Rabcer IT 20mg/150mg capsules. Dosage modification may be necessary; physician consultation is advised.
What if you forget to take Rabcer IT 20mg/150mg Capsule :
Should you forget to take a Rabcer IT 20mg/150mg Capsule, administer it at your earliest convenience.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ing pattern. Avoid taking a double dose.
